Output 956bf094f86a6fa6e56820a5eab52531b9419160dbee2da760c47ff932126337:0

value
143899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d62eec7809524614398672e4422afb161db142d OP_EQUALVERIFY OP_CHECKSIG
address
16bajfmN7V52ejGP6X2wENDyQ3cYqyeSWz
transaction
956bf094f86a6fa6e56820a5eab52531b9419160dbee2da760c47ff932126337
spent
true